Another AI update announced by OpenAI is the availability of the ChatGPT premium plan, which costs just ₹399/month. The ChatGPT premium plan in India is called ChatGPT Go. This launch is a big step by OpenAI towards making AI tools more accessible to everyday users, especially in a price-sensitive market like India. As we know, India’s economy is growing with AI tools day by day, as nowadays everyone is using and taking advantage of popular AI tools like ChatGPT, Google Gemini, and Perplexity, which are already available in the market. However, there are some limitations in the free versions of AI tools, but today we are here to tell you about the solution and what you should know if you use AI daily.
According to The Economic Times, this new plan is lower than the flagship ChatGPT Plus (₹1,999/month) and the higher-tier Pro subscription. For Indian users, the biggest feature is local UPI payments, which finally removes the hassle of foreign card transactions and makes access to premium AI tools easier. Plus Plan & Pro Plan
The Plus plan costs around ₹1,999/month and is a good option for users who need faster responses, access during peak hours, and a seamless experience. This plan is not just for casual users—it’s more suited for freelancers, writers, or professionals who use AI on a daily basis for productivity. For example, if you’re running a blog, doing freelance writing, or need constant AI support without interruptions, Plus gives you that reliability. I think it’s worth the money if you want stability and speed and don’t want to be slowed down by usage limits. The Pro plan is designed for advanced users, teams, or professionals who want to use ChatGPT as a serious tool for business or research. Although it costs more at ₹19,900/month, you’re paying for more robust capabilities—such as handling larger workloads, advanced data analysis, longer reference memory, and more powerful AI models. In my opinion, this plan is best suited if you are running a company, managing multiple projects, or if AI is directly related to your revenue and business growth. It’s not for everyone, but if your work requires maximum performance and reliability, Pro would be the right choice for those professionals.

How much does the ChatGPT Premium Plan cost in India?
In India, the Go plan is priced at ₹399/month. Plus and Pro versions are available at higher prices, offering additional features for users with heavy AI usage needs.
